Totton Station provides essential amenities for travelers, primarily focused on efficiency and convenience. Ticket purchasing is made easy with a ticket office open from Monday to Friday between 05:40 and 10:00, and ticket machines are available at all hours to collect tickets bought online. Those with accessibility needs can rest assured that the station has accessible machines that cater to users with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. Although lacking full step-free platform access, the station does offer ramp access for trains.
Despite lacking some facilities like toilets and refreshments, the station prioritizes safety and comfort with CCTV surveillance and a heated waiting room open on weekdays. Cycle enthusiasts will find decent bicycle storage with 24 spaces, including locks and racks, although no rental services are available. For those traveling with additional needs, the helpful onboard guards provide assistance throughout operational hours.
Navigating onward from Totton Station is well-facilitated by a variety of transport links. The rail replacement service operates efficiently with stops marked on Commercial Road and High Street for easy transfers to Southampton. Those preferring bus travel can access information to plan their journey beyond Totton here. Car parking is limited, with 11 spaces available, but includes a smart hourly rate using the RingGo payment system.

The station offers basic yet functional facilities to accommodate its passengers. While the ticket office is open from Monday to Friday between 07:30 and 10:00, ticket machines are available for those purchasing or collecting tickets at more flexible hours. Access for wheelchair users is made easier with accessible ticket machines and step-free access on parts of the station.
Although there aren't any shops, refreshment facilities, ATMs, or even toilets on site, customer help points ensure passenger services are still available. The presence of CCTV enhances security, offering peace of mind to travelers who might be leaving their bicycles at the available 9 bike stands. Although there's no wheelchair-accessible taxi service directly available, passengers are encouraged to book assistance in advance or use the "Turn-up-and-go" service provided by the London Overground.
Getting around from Caledonian Road & Barnsbury is straightforward, albeit with some minor planning involved. There are no direct rail replacement services from the station itself. For rail replacement services heading east towards Stratford, or west towards Gospel Oak/Hampstead Heath, take a bus from the stops at Highbury & Islington station nearby. If you are looking to explore more of London, the Caledonian Road underground station is only a short 10-minute walk away, giving you access to the bustling Piccadilly Line.
